Juventus could reportedly sell Mario Mandzukic and bring back Gonzalo Higuain if Maurizio Sarri takes over as Coach this summer.

According to Goal.com’s Romeo Agresti, there seems to be ‘no space’ for Mandzukic in Sarri’s project for Juve.

The Croat only signed a new contract until 2021 in April and is a fan favourite in Turin, but Agresti claims the Chelsea boss wants a different option in attack.

That is where Higuain would come in, with the Bianconeri able to recall the Argentine from his loan spell at Chelsea.

The 31-year-old was the Bianconeri’s record signing when he arrived from Napoli in the summer of 2016.

He went on to score 55 goals in two seasons but was ousted in terms of both transfer fee and status by Cristiano Ronaldo.

Higuain subsequently linked back up with Sarri at Stamford Bridge in January, netting five times in the Premier League and winning a Europa League.
